You will find normally a few major levels during the perception of pain. The first phase is pain sensitivity, followed by the second phase the place the signals are transmitted through the periphery to your dorsal horn (DH), which is situated within the spinal wire by means of the peripheral nervous technique (PNS). Lastly, the 3rd stage would be to accomplish the transmission from the indicators to the upper brain by means of the central anxious process (CNS). Commonly, There's two routes for signal transmissions to be performed: ascending and descending pathways. The pathway that goes upward carrying sensory info from the human body by means of the spinal wire in the direction of the brain is defined since the ascending pathway, whereas the nerves that goes downward with the Mind on the reflex organs by using the spinal cord is recognized as the descending pathway.

Pain is looked upon as a human primate instinct and will be described being a distressing feeling, and also an psychological expertise that's associated with real or possible tissue destruction, with the only intent of notifying the body’s defence mechanism to respond toward a stimulus in order to steer clear of even further tissue damages. The sensation of pain is affiliated with the activation of the receptors in the first afferent fibers, which happens to be inclusive from the unmyelinated C-fiber and myelinated Aσ-fiber. Equally nociceptors remain silent through homeostasis in the absence of pain and are activated when There exists a potential of noxious stimulus. The notion of the number of sensory occasions is required to the Mind as a way to detect pain and make a response to the threat.

Histamine, performing by using unique histamine H1, H2, H3, and H4 receptors, regulates different physiological and pathological procedures, including pain. In the final 20 years, There have been a particular boost in evidence to assist the involvement of H3 receptor and H4 receptor during the modulation of neuropathic pain, which stays challenging with regards to administration.
